Joseph’s Death

March 27, 2009

Jacob had Joseph swear on oath that when Jacob died Joseph would bury him in the land of Canaan. Jacob died and Joseph asked Pharaoh to leave the country to bury his father. Pharaoh gave permission and also sent many others along with Joseph.

Totally Forgiven

March 17, 2009

Jacob (Israel) has just passed away in Egypt. He has been re-united with his son Joseph. The brothers who sold Joseph into slavery years earlier are also living in Egypt.
